Hi, I have a problem with SoapUI, I use a wsdl which is tested using wcftest tool other than SoapUi, it worked fine, but when I tried to use SOAP UI I got following error: HTTP/1.1 500 Internal Server Error Content-Length: 770 Content-Type: application/soap+xml; charset=utf-8 Server: Microsoft-HTTPAPI/2.0 Date: Wed, 02 Dec 2009 00:16:49 GMT s:Sender a:ActionNotSupported The message with Action '' cannot be processed at the receiver, due to a ContractFilter mismatch at the EndpointDispatcher. This may be because of either a contract mismatch (mismatched Actions between sender and receiver) or a binding/security mismatch between the sender and the receiver. Check that sender and receiver have the same contract and the same binding (including security requirements, e.g. Message, Transport, None). basically that it complaint that I didno't specify the soap action in my request, but I tried to find where can I add it, I only find the place for ws-a action which is different from the soap action, in one of post I found on web, which said that it should be "action" in the http header, is part of Content-Type, but I tried it, it aslo gave me a bad request error.
